Personal Protective Equipment (PPE) for Exhaust System Maintenance

Personal protective equipment (PPE) is vital during exhaust system maintenance to ensure safety from potential hazards. Proper PPE minimizes exposure to harmful substances such as exhaust gases, fumes, and hot components. It acts as a barrier to protect the respiratory system, skin, and eyes from injury or irritation.

Respirators or mask devices are essential, especially when working in confined spaces or when there is a risk of inhaling toxic fumes. Gloves made from heat-resistant or chemical-resistant materials are recommended to prevent burns and contact with hazardous substances. Eye protection, such as safety glasses or goggles, guards against debris, sparks, and splashes that may occur during repairs.

Wearing flame-resistant clothing or coveralls is advisable to shield the body from burns caused by hot components or accidental sparks. Additionally, sturdy work boots provide stability and protect feet from falling objects or hot surfaces. Employing appropriate PPE ensures comprehensive safety precautions are maintained during exhaust system maintenance, ultimately reducing the risk of injury or health issues.

Safe Inspection and Repair Practices

Safe inspection and repair practices for engine exhaust systems are vital to ensure both personal safety and the vehicle’s proper functioning. Before beginning any inspection, it is necessary to verify that the engine is turned off and has cooled sufficiently to prevent burns from hot components. Adequate lighting and protective gear, such as gloves and safety glasses, should be used to minimize injury risks.

During inspection, visual checks should focus on locating cracks, rust, loose fittings, or signs of exhaust gas leaks. Repair procedures must follow manufacturer guidelines, employing proper tools and techniques to secure components effectively. Avoiding shortcuts and ensuring fittings are tightly secured prevents exhaust leaks that could compromise safety.

It is important to regularly test for leaks using appropriate diagnostic methods, like smoke tests or exhaust gas analyzers, especially after repairs. Proper venting and work in well-ventilated areas reduce exposure to harmful fumes during inspection and repair tasks. By adhering to these safe practices, technicians can significantly reduce the risk of accidents or long-term health issues related to exhaust system maintenance.

Avoiding Leaks and Exhaust Gas Escapes

Ensuring a secure connection between all exhaust system components is vital to prevent leaks and exhaust gas escapes. Properly tightening clamps, bolts, and fittings during installation helps maintain the system’s integrity. Regular inspection confirms that these connections remain secure over time.

Using high-quality, compatible gaskets and sealing materials is essential to create airtight seals at junctions and flanges. Worn or damaged gaskets should be replaced promptly to avoid leaks that can release harmful gases. Proper sealing safeguards both vehicle performance and driver safety.

Early detection of leaks is facilitated by visual inspections and the use of smoke tests or soapy water solutions to identify escaping gases. Addressing small leaks immediately prevents escalation into costly repairs and mitigates environmental hazards. Consistent maintenance ensures the exhaust system remains free from leaks and exhaust gas escapes.

Handling and Disposal of Exhaust System Components and Fluids

Handling and disposal of exhaust system components and fluids require careful attention to safety and environmental guidelines. Proper procedures help prevent exposure to hazardous substances and ensure regulatory compliance.

When managing old parts and fluids, always wear appropriate personal protective equipment (PPE) such as gloves, goggles, and respiratory protection. This minimizes risk during removal, handling, or disposal.

A recommended approach includes:

  1. Collecting used parts and fluids separately to prevent contamination.
  2. Transporting waste materials in sealed, clearly labeled containers.
  3. Following local regulations for disposal or recycling of exhaust components, especially catalytic converters and filters.
  4. Ensuring fluids like oil, coolant, and condensates are disposed of through certified waste management services.

Adhering to these safety precautions reduces environmental impact and protects health. Proper handling of exhaust system components and fluids is essential for maintaining a safe workshop environment and minimizing potential hazards.
